Thinkific vs Podia: what the data says
When buyers ask AI assistants like ChatGPT, Claude and Gemini to recommend online course platform, Thinkific is recommended more often than Podia — scoring 66/100 for AI visibility versus 14/100. Thinkific shows up in 70% of AI answers to real buyer questions; Podia shows up in 20%.
The gap is widest on ChatGPT, where Thinkific is clearly favoured: Thinkific is recommended 80% of the time and Podia 20%. Because each engine draws on different sources, a brand can lead on one and trail on another — which is why it pays to track all three rather than assume one result holds everywhere.
In practice, an AI assistant asked “What is the best online course platform for beginners?” is far likely to put Thinkific on its shortlist. Podia is largely invisible in AI answers for online course platform — and since these shortlists are increasingly where buying decisions start, that's a gap worth closing.

How is AI visibility measured?
Ranklisted runs the real questions buyers ask AI assistants about online course platform across ChatGPT, Claude and Gemini, records whether each brand is recommended and where it ranks, and turns it into a 0–100 score. It's re-checked weekly.
